We've had some pretty rotten times since being relegated from the Championship, we've watched kids, waifs and strays play for us, we've seen the team battle to stay in the league and scared of making a mistake and we've seen a functional team reach the play-offs.

Now we have an entertaining and attacking team that also has the freedom, work rate and skill to go places this season.

Rather than going to games as a duty, now it's in anticipation.

"Some" of the football we play is the best attacking and entertaining football I've seen since the Shilton era.
